Looking forward to longer and brighter days ahead, we gather to celebrate our Winter Solstice theme of Surfacing.

Our two Solstice services accommodate those who can gather outdoors and those who prefer to view the service online. You are invited to attend either or both.
On Monday, December 20th, our outdoor ritual will take place at 7:00 pm in the CUUC parking lot. For this in-person ritual, we will gather in the front of our church to celebrate our Solstice theme of Surfacing. Invite family and friends, neighbors and people of all ages, as we gather for an evening of drumming, music, reflection, and a bonfire to bless our church and welcome the return of the sun. Please park on the street. Dress for cold weather as we’ll be outdoors for the entire evening. If needed, please bring a chair. Bring a mug for hot cider afterwards!
